Cleaning and Maintenance

Unplug the coffee maker before cleaning. Use a damp cloth to clean the exterior and a soft brush for the grinder.

CAUTION! Do not immerse the coffee maker in water; clean removable parts separately.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
No powerUnplugged or faulty outletCheck power connection and outlet.
Weak coffeeInsufficient coffee groundsAdd more coffee grounds to the filter.
Overflowing carafeToo much waterReduce the amount of water in the reservoir.
Grinder not workingBlocked or jammedClean the grinder and remove any blockages.
